McLaren tease the New F1 (P12)
Wed, 05 Sep 2012With a debut at the Paris Motor Show on 27th September, McLaren releases the first teaser photo of their new hypercar. We’ve been anticipating the reveal of the new McLaren F1 – the McLaren P12 – for some time, and expected it to appear at Pebble Beach last month. The new car at Pebble Beach turned out to be the McLaren X-1 (although McLaren did take an iPad presentation of the new F1 for the delectation of the privileged few) but now we know for certain that the new McLaren will get its public debut at the 2012 Paris Motor Show.

Faster Gumpert Apollo model to debut in Geneva
Thu, 12 Feb 2009They may not be lookers, but there is no denying the performance credentials of Roland Gumpert's Apollo sports cars. With the base 650-hp engine package, the brainchild of the former director of Audi Sport is capable of reaching 60 mph in less than three seconds with a top speed or more than 200 mph. But now Gumpert is planning to reveal a faster chapter in the line at next month's Geneva motor show with the Apollo Speed.
